Creamy Garlic Shrimp Alfredo Pasta
Ingredients
For the Pasta:
12 oz fettuccine or linguine
Salt (for boiling water)
For the Shrimp:
1 lb large shrimp (peeled and deveined)
1 tsp smoked paprika
1 tsp garlic powder
Salt and black pepper to taste
2 tbsp olive oil
For the Alfredo Sauce:
3 tbsp unsalted butter
3 cloves garlic (minced)
1 1/2 cups heavy cream
1 cup grated Parmesan cheese
1 tsp Italian seasoning
Salt and pepper to taste
For Garnish:
Fresh parsley (chopped)
Instructions
Cook the Pasta:
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Cook the fettuccine according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.
Prepare the Shrimp:
Season shrimp with paprika, garlic powder, salt, and pepper.
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Cook shrimp for 2-3 minutes per side until pink and cooked through. Remove and set aside.
Make the Alfredo Sauce:
In the same skillet, melt butter over medium heat. Add minced garlic and sauté until fragrant (about 1 minute).
Stir in heavy cream and bring to a simmer. Gradually add Parmesan cheese, whisking until the sauce is smooth. Season with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per.
Combine:
Add the cooked pasta to the sauce, tossing to coat. Return the shrimp to the skillet and gently mix everything together.
Serve:
Plate the pasta and garnish with fresh parsley for a burst of flavor and color.
